Merge git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/pablo/nf-next
Pablo Neira Ayuso says: ==================== Netfilter updates for net-next The following patchset contains Netfilter updates for net-next: 1) Rename 'searched' column to 'clashres' in conntrack /proc/ stats to amend a recent patch, from Florian Westphal. 2) Remove unused nft_data_debug(), from YueHaibing. 3) Remove unused definitions in IPVS, also from YueHaibing. 4) Fix user data memleak in tables and objects, this is also amending a recent patch, from Jose M. Guisado. 5) Use nla_memdup() to allocate user data in table and objects, also from Jose M. Guisado 6) User data support for chains, from Jose M. Guisado 7) Remove unused definition in nf_tables_offload, from YueHaibing. 8) Use kvzalloc() in ip_set_alloc(), from Vasily Averin. 9) Fix false positive reported by lockdep in nfnetlink mutexes, from Florian Westphal. 10) Extend fast variant of cmp for neq operation, from Phil Sutter. 11) Implement fast bitwise variant, also from Phil Sutter. ==================== Signed-off-by: David S. Miller <davem@davemloft.net>
